Seher Latif is an independent producer and casting director based in Mumbai. She started her career as a Production Associate and worked on numerous television commercials at the highly regarded ad film production house White Light Moving Picture Company Private Limited. She has independently produced a Hindi language short “Taala Aur Chaabi” in 2010 and has produced a widely watched and critically acclaimed trilingual (English-Hindi and Marathi) musical stage production of Rudyard Kipling’s ‘The Jungle Book” in 2012. The show continues its run in various cities in India and Dubai having completed over 35 shows. As a casting director she has worked on a variety of films – large studio productions like Sony Columbia’s “Eat Pray Love”, Kathryn Bigelow’s Oscar-nominated spythriller “Zero Dark Thirty”, the modest but surprise Fox Searchlight worldwide hit “The Best Exotic Marigold Hotel” helmed by Oscar-nominated British director John Madden, Walt Disney’s upcoming film directed by Craig Gillespie titled “Million Dollar Arm” among others, and joyously Indian independent films like “The Monsoon Shootout” directed by Amit Kumar, “Gandhi of the Month” directed by Kranti Kanade with Harvey Keitel and most recently Ritesh Batra’s intimate and endearing film “The Lunchbox” that premiered at the Cannes International Film Festival 2013 to rave reviews. She is currently developing a hybrid documentary with director Ritesh Batra titled “A Place in The Future”.
